
Homeowners in Colorado Springs and Aurora know that the Rocky Mountain climate presents unique challenges for roofs. From intense sun and rapid temperature changes to heavy snowfall and hail, your roof works hard to protect your home. Regular maintenance and timely repairs are key to its longevity.
When you're thinking about roofing tar or needing repairs in Colorado, consider the impact of our diverse climate. The intense UV rays from the sun can degrade roofing materials over time, while significant snowfall can add considerable weight and lead to ice dams. Hailstorms, though less frequent than in some other states, can still cause damage. The cost of roof repairs in Colorado is influenced by the extent of wear and tear from these elements, the specific materials required for a lasting fix, and the complexity of the repair work itself.

Roofing tar can be used for very small, temporary seals on Colorado roofs to address minor issues. However, due to our intense sun and potential for freeze-thaw cycles, more robust and permanent repair solutions are typically needed for long-term effectiveness.
